Powerful fruit filled nose, generous open bouquet. Wine is wonderfully long and chewy. Walnut and blackcurrant give this balanced wine individuality. Tanins were soft but still present in this wine which will only get better. This wine is a bargain at $45(IMHO). Reminded me of the '82 Leoville Poyferre. Gotta go buy more!
